Usually, the sixth month within the Backyard State brings a transition from spring to summer time, characterised by rising temperatures, humidity, and sunshine. Day by day common highs rise from the low 70s (F) at first of the month to the low 80s by the top. In a single day lows additionally enhance, shifting from the mid-50s to the mid-60s. Rainfall is mostly distributed all through the month, with occasional thunderstorms turning into extra frequent because the month progresses.

5. Thunderstorms
Occasional thunderstorms are a attribute function of June climate in New Jersey. These storms come up from the interaction of a number of meteorological elements prevalent throughout this month. Growing temperatures, coupled with rising humidity, create an unstable ambiance. Heat, moist air rises quickly, colliding with cooler air plenty aloft. This collision results in condensation, the formation of cumulonimbus clouds, and the eventual launch of vitality within the type of thunderstorms. The frequency of thunderstorms sometimes will increase as June progresses, reflecting the rising instability of the ambiance.
These thunderstorms, whereas occasional, play a big function within the state’s hydrological cycle. They ship a considerable portion of June’s whole rainfall, contributing to groundwater recharge and reservoir ranges. Nevertheless, the localized and infrequently intense nature of those storms also can result in challenges. Flash flooding can happen in city areas and areas with poor drainage. Robust winds related to thunderstorms may cause injury to property and vegetation. Lightning strikes pose a threat to security and might ignite wildfires, notably in periods of dry vegetation. For instance, the June 2015 thunderstorms resulted in localized flooding throughout a number of counties in New Jersey, highlighting the potential impression of those climate occasions.

Steadily Requested Questions
This FAQ part addresses frequent inquiries concerning typical June climate situations in New Jersey. Understanding these patterns is important for planning actions and mitigating potential weather-related disruptions.
Query 1: How scorching does it sometimes get in New Jersey throughout June?
Common excessive temperatures progressively enhance all through June, starting from the low 70s Fahrenheit at first of the month to the low 80s by the top. In a single day lows sometimes vary from the mid-50s to the mid-60s.
Query 2: How a lot rain can one count on in New Jersey in June?
New Jersey receives a median of 3-4 inches of rainfall in June, usually distributed all through the month within the type of showers and occasional thunderstorms.
Query 3: Is June a damp month in New Jersey?
Sure, humidity ranges sometimes enhance all through June, contributing to the muggy situations usually skilled, particularly within the latter half of the month.
Query 4: Are thunderstorms frequent in New Jersey throughout June?
Thunderstorms turn into extra frequent as June progresses on account of rising warmth and humidity, creating an unstable ambiance conducive to thunderstorm growth.
Query 5: What’s the typical daylight period in New Jersey throughout June?
June presents considerable sunshine with a median of 14-15 hours of daylight, offering ample alternatives for out of doors actions.
